Soften/Melt

Soften and Melt functions may be used to soften or melt your
food. Times and cooking powers have been preset for a number
of food types. Use the following chart as a guide.

SOFTEN CHART

To Soften:

1. Touch SOFTEN/MELT.

2. Touch number key “2” to select Soften function

OR
Touch SOFTEN/MELT repeatedly to scan and select Soften.

3. Touch number key to select food type from the Soften Chart

OR
Touch SOFTEN/MELT repeatedly to scan and select food
settings.

4. Touch number keys to enter quantity (weight or sticks).

To change the doneness setting, touch the Power key before
or after the “START?” prompt is displayed to toggle through
and select a doneness of Normal, More, or Less.

5. Touch START.

The upper oven display will count down the soften time.

When the stop time is reached, the oven will shut off
automatically and “soften complete” will appear in the
display.

If enabled, end-of-cycle tones will sound, then reminder
tones will sound every minute.

6. Touch OFF or open the door to clear the display and/or stop

reminder tones.

MELT CHART

To Melt:

1. Touch SOFTEN/MELT.

2. Touch number key “1” to select Melt function

OR
Touch SOFTEN/MELT repeatedly to scan and select Melt.

3. Touch number key to select food type from the Melt Chart

OR
Touch SOFTEN/MELT repeatedly to scan and select food
settings.

4. Touch number keys to enter quantity (weight or sticks).

To change the doneness setting, touch the Power key before
or after the “START?” prompt is displayed to toggle through
and select a doneness of Normal, More, or Less.

5. Touch START.

The upper oven display will count down the melt time.

When the stop time is reached, the oven will shut off
automatically and “melt complete” will appear in the display.

If enabled, end-of-cycle tones will sound, then reminder
tones will sound every minute.

6. Touch OFF or open the door to clear the display and/or stop

reminder tones.

EasyConvect™ Conversion

Convection cooking uses the convection element, the broil
element and the fan. Hot air is circulated throughout the oven
cavity by the fan. The constantly moving air surrounds the food to
heat the outer portion quickly.

The convect function may be used to cook small amounts of
food on a single rack.

Always use the convection grid placed on turntable or baking
tray.

Always use the turntable “On” option when convection
cooking with the convection grid (default setting).

Do not cover turntable or convection grid or baking tray with
aluminum foil.

Do not use light plastic containers, plastic wrap or paper
products. All heatproof cookware or metal utensils can be
used in convection cooking. Round pizza pans are excellent
for convection cooking.
